Priority of fire-fighting vehicles in emergency
Fire-fighting vehicles, whether public or private, have **right of way** only when they are on an **urgent service** and are **correctly signaling** (using emergency lights and siren).
What other users should do:
- **Facilitate their passage**: normally move **to the right**.
- **Stop** if necessary to avoid hindering their movement.
- Avoid **blocking intersections** or changes of direction.
Outside of these conditions, **general priority rules** apply.
